BodyWorks
An exhibition all about how your body works, with the chance to perform a virtual autopsy, run in a giant hamster wheel and become a 'snot ninja' (lovely). Compare your physiological stats with other visitors and find out about all the latest scientific research into your very own body.

Burghley Game and Country Fair
Get your agricultural on with the sixth annual Game and Country Fair, featuring falconry, gun dog and sheepdog displays, fishing ferret racing and even 'horse skateboarding' at the National Horse Boarding Championship. There's also a slew of craft tents, cookery demonstrations and trade stands for human folk.
